Indholdsfortegnelse:

Sådan opretter du et bærbart smart spejl/make -up -boks: 8 trin
Sådan opretter du et bærbart smart spejl/make -up -boks: 8 trin

Video: Sådan opretter du et bærbart smart spejl/make -up -boks: 8 trin

Video: Sådan opretter du et bærbart smart spejl/make -up -boks: 8 trin
Video: Как Снимать Себя На Видео На Смартфон || Как Качественно Снимать Видеоблог На Телефон 2024, Juli
Anonim
Sådan opretter du et bærbart smart spejl/make -up -boks
Sådan opretter du et bærbart smart spejl/make -up -boks

Som et afsluttende projekt for min slutsten på Davis & Elkins college, satte jeg mig for at designe og oprette en rejseboks sammen med et større spejl og udnyttelse af en hindbærpi og den magiske spejlsoftwareplatform, der ville fungere som en bærbar variant af det typiske smarte spejl. Den magiske spejlplatform er unik i sin modularitet, hvilket tillader total frihed i funktion og design!

Trin 1: Hvad skal du bruge

Dele: En rejse -make -up boks med et hult muslingelåg En lys strimmel A hindbær pi 3A hindbær pi GPIO -drevet skærm Et ark tynd tovejsspejl akryl Alle disse dele blev hentet fra Amazon (bortset fra Pi, som blev lånt til mig med henblik på dette projekt) En rulle elektrisk tapeTømmer: Jeg brugte 1/4 "balsa til rådighed for mig via mit college's maker space. Du skal bruge stykket til at være mindst 2'x1,5 'for at skære i størrelse til vores stel Værktøjer: Drill og 1/4 "bit A Dremel med et skærehjul og en slibeskive A Lazer cutter

Trin 2: Skæring af rammen

Vores stel er designet som en friktionspasning, hvilket betyder, at ingen anelse eller skruer holder den på plads. For at opnå dette målte jeg indersiden af mit liv samt målte vinklen på de afrundede hjørner. For kassen jeg brugte endte det med at være (!! Indsæt endelige målinger her !!) Men hvis du vælger en kasse i en anden størrelse, vil dette påvirke dimensioner af din ramme. Jeg skar også ca. 1/4 væk fra hver side op til hjørnerne. Jeg skitserede rammen op ved hjælp af Fusion 360, tak til studielicenser, og importerede denne skitse til Inkscape, et gratis illustratorprogram, der skulle skæres

Trin 3: Skæring af spejlet

At skære vores spejlstykke ud af akrylen er langt fra en af de lettere dele til projektet. Det er proceduremæssigt, præcis det samme som at skære vores ramme, men med en meget mere enkel skitse! Du skal blot tegne et rektangel på størrelse med hullet, der er skåret ud i vores ramme med en ekstra ~ 1/4 på hver side, så det kan sættes på bagsiden af rammen

Trin 4: Ændring af boksen

Ændringer i boksen
Ændringer i boksen

Min make -up boks havde brug for en hel del ændringer for at fungere til dette projekt, dette blev udført for tidens skyld fuldstændigt, og i fremtiden håber jeg at få et eget boksdesign. Den første ting, du vil gøre, er at skære hjørnerne ud med en dremel, cirka 1/4 dyb, dette vil tillade vores ramme at låse sig fast med basen og lukke tæt. Det næste trin er at skære et hul ud i bagenden til vores netledning. Til dette borede jeg to huller side om side på det bageste hjørne og brugte derefter en Dremel til at forbinde de to huller og skabe et enkelt aflangt pilleformet hul, da min mikrousb havde en temmelig tyk krave til at passe igennem Til sidst slibes alt ned for at gøre det glat og berøre eventuelle fejl

Trin 5: Trin 5: Lys

Trin 5: Lys!
Trin 5: Lys!

Ingen forfængelighed er komplet uden belysning! Så til vores bærbare forfængelighed valgte jeg at bruge en USB -lysstrimmel. Jeg brugte den samme boreteknik som vores hul bag i boksen til strøm, men med en mindre 1/16 bit. Dette gav mig lige nok plads til at arbejde strimlen igennem. Så er det kun tilbage at sikre filmen over strimmelens klæbemiddel fjernes og placeres strimlen fast på rammen. Sidebemærkning: Ideelt set ville du bruge en Phillips Hue -lysstrimmel, fordi den er bred interoperabilitet med MagicMirror eller IFTTT, hvilket muliggør håndfri betjening på bekostning af den tid, du skriver din protokol eller installation af et modul. Men for dette projekt var omkostninger en faktor, at Hue -strip koster $ 80 på Amazon, hvilket er mere end hele projektet ellers, og i betragtning af hvor lidt af strimlen der bruges til dette projekt, er det uklogt for dette Den anden advarsel til bedre funktionalitet er, at en mere sofistikeret strip som Phillips Hue -stripen kræver en netværksbro, der er tilsluttet direkte til din givne netværksrouter, som neutraliserer meget af portabiliteten.

Trin 6: Trin 6: Ikke et stykke kage, men et stykke Pi

Raspberry pi er hjertet i bygningen og kræver en god smule opsætning. HDMI -problemer er langtfra et af de mest almindelige problemer med hindbærpi. For at undgå disse problemer er det eneste, du skal gøre, at redigere nogle indstillinger i boot -konfigurationen. For at redigere denne fil skal du åbne den i en terminalbaseret editor, jeg brugte nano. Der er to linjer, der skal tilføjes, eller hvis de allerede er til stede, skal de kommentere dem ved at slette "#" -tegnet før hver linje. De linjer, du skal tilføje, er "hdmi_force_hotplug = 1" og "hdmi_drive = 2". Disse linjer hjælper dig med fremtidig opgradering og fejlfinding. De sikrer, at HDMI har maksimal kompatibilitet med forskellige skærme, så når du tager pi'en ud for at arbejde på den, bør du ikke støde på problemer med at få en skærm ud.

Trin 7: Trin 7: Installation af softwaren

For at få softwarsiden til dette projekt i gang skal du åbne din terminal og indtaste følgende "bash -c" $ (curl -sL https://raw.githubusercontent.com/MichMich/MagicMirror/master/installers/ raspberry.sh) "" "Dette får fat i autoinstallatøren fra GitHub og kommer i gang. Det næste trin er at sikre, at spejlsoftwaren starter ved opstart og vigtigst af alt genstarter sig selv. Dette er nødvendigt for at undgå at skulle fjerne frontpladen og tilslutte en mus og et tastatur hver gang du tænder spejlet. For at gøre dette bruger vi PM2, som er en procesmanager til node.js -applikationer. PM2 i vores tilfælde vil kun sikre, at vores system altid er i stand til at have spejlet kørende og minimal nedetid, hvis der opstår et nedbrud. Først skal du tilbage til din terminal og udføre følgende kommandoer: sudo npm install -g pm2pm2 opstart Disse kommandoer installerer PM2 og tilføjer det til listen over opstartsprogrammer. Derefter skal vi lave scriptet til vores spejl til at starte. For at gøre dette skal du udføre: cd ~ nano mm.sh Dette vil oprette et tomt script og sætte dig ind i nano -editoren for det script, tilføje følgende linjer og derefter sørge for at gemme ~/MagicMirrorDISPLAY =: 0 npm startNow alt, der er tilbage, er at sikre, at vores script forbliver kørende, i din terminal udføres endnu en gang: pm2 start mm.shpm2 saveNu vil pi holde softwaren kørende 99,9% af tiden, dette kan deaktiveres med kommandoen "pm2 stop mm"

Trin 8: Efterbehandling

Tag din rulle elektrisk tape og beklæd forsigtigt indersiden af låget. Dette vil mørklægge ryggen og give bedre refleksion gennem spejlet, men også holde pi sikker. Derefter tilføjede jeg nogle træstumper (også dækket med elektrisk tape) med varm lim for at holde pi’en på plads og førte alt kablet til den. Derfra skal du bare passe rammen ind i låget, og voila! Du er færdig! Du skal have en bærbar smart forfængelighed klar til brug, eller du kan komme i gang med at tilpasse dit spejl! Moduler, der allerede er lavet, kan findes på https://github.com/MichMich/MagicMirror/wiki/3rd-party-modules, eller hvis du vil skrive dit eget, kan udviklingsdokumentation findes på https://github.com /MichMich/MagicMirror/blob/master/modules

Anbefalede: